Understanding Senolytic Compounds
Senolytic compounds are substances that target and eliminate senescent cells, which are damaged cells that accumulate as we age. These 'zombie cells' release inflammatory molecules that lead to chronic diseases and physical decline. Research indicates that lifestyle factors, such as stress and poor diet, can exacerbate the accumulation of senescent cells and hinder the body's ability to clear them. By utilizing both pharmaceutical advancements and natural compounds, individuals can strengthen their cellular health and improve their lifespan.
